The controls of the dialog itself are divided into two methods of correcting photographs:

 

Better-Colors-Dialog

 

Top right shows HSV (Hue Saturation Value) and CMYK (Cyan Magenta Yellow Black). If the basic colors are right, but they are lacking in "strength" then use the HSV method. See lesson 4 for an example of using this color correction method.

 

To use the CMYK sliders (bottom right in the dialog) you need to know about the printing process, which is beyond the scope of this help file, though there are plenty of sources on the internet.
